| Computational Description (TAIR10) |
N-acetylglucosaminylphosphatidylinositol de-N-acetylase family protein; FUNCTIONS IN: molecular_function unknown; INVOLVED IN: biological_process unknown; LOCATED IN: endomembrane system; CONTAINS InterPro DOMAIN/s: N-acetylglucosaminyl phosphatidylinositol deacetylase (InterPro:IPR003737); BEST Arabidopsis thaliana protein match is: N-acetylglucosaminylphosphatidylinositol de-N-acetylase family protein (TAIR:AT2G27340.4); Has 566 Blast hits to 562 proteins in 260 species: Archae - 0; Bacteria - 161; Metazoa - 106; Fungi - 162; Plants - 52; Viruses - 0; Other Eukaryotes - 85 (source: NCBI BLink). | ||||||||||||||||||||||||||||||||||||||||
